Nature and trails
The 5.2 km hiking trail of the Walk of Peace leads from Opatje selo via Nova vas, Županov vrh and Kremenjak to Sela na Krasu. This 5.2 km hike is part of the Way of Peace from the Alps to the Adriatic. A well-maintained gravel cycling and hiking path leads to Županov vrh and an 8-metre-high masonry border watchtower of the former Yugoslav People's Army (JLA).
There is also a well-defined route for horseback riding: a 25 km circular riding trail leads through Sela na Krasu. From Sela na Krasu, the riding trail runs northwards along the route of the former military railway. A forest path leads to the Vodarna Sela na Krasu viewpoint. A paragliding launch site is located next to this viewpoint. From the Vodarna Sela na Krasu viewpoint, Trstelj, Kostanjevica, Temnica and the Cerje monument can be seen. Sela na Krasu itself also offers views of the Adriatic.
Culture and history
The Church of the Assumption of Mary, “Cerkev Marijinega vnebovzetja”, stands in the village square of Sela na Krasu. It was first mentioned in 1753. A memorial to the Slovenian professor and journalist Filip Peric also stands in the village square. The old school building is another historic landmark in the village; it was built in 1894.
Today, only the ruins of the former wall that surrounded the Podgrac hillfort remain visible on the site. The former prehistoric Podgrac hillfort is attributed to the Late Bronze Age and the Iron Age based on ceramic finds. Village life and outdoor activities
The sports park in Sela na Krasu offers facilities for playing football, basketball and boccia, as well as a children's playground. Another specific facility is the PZA Sela na Krasu motorhome stop, with 14 spaces for motorhomes. The site is located on the edge of the village and offers views of the Adriatic.
Culinary experiences
The local gastronomy includes the Osmica Pri Krčarju at Sela na Krasu 3, 5296 Kostanjevica na Krasu. It opens twice a year and offers cured meat products and homemade wine. Its seasonally limited opening and specific offering give this place a clearly defined culinary character.
